    I went and played the 70 today. I have the 50 w expansion since last fall.. I like it a bunch.. the 70 has some cool upgrades. Essentially it’s what I have on steroids. I thought I’d buy the 1250 today but without Bluetooth audio I’m holding off. 1250 is offered at $999.00 currently. Great deal. Im really tempted because I believe they are going to discontinue the 1250 soon. That really puts me in a conundrum. BT Audio is a big deal for me but the physical size of the 1250 kit is also a big deal too.. the 1250 at GC today wasn’t in good set up mode.. the snare was loose, the sound wasn’t hooked up so I really didn’t get to give it a chance.. I can always buy a $16.00 Bluetooth plug on device and turn the 1250 into BT Audio.. so there ya go.. decisions decisions… I’m going back to GC tomorrow and get them to hook it up properly and let me tighten up the heads and plug in my headphones and go at it with some music.. that should help.. the “floor Tom’s are 10” too which is huge.. and the cymbals are larger.. huge.. thd dual Tom’s is cool but both 70 and 1250 have em…I’ll let y’all know after tomorrow..

      At this price point there are no challengers. Super sturdy rack. Amazing sounds. Do customize even preset kits. I am sending kit to a mini powered mixer w/ a 5 headphone splitter jack so the whole band can play along. The mixer makes this kit even sound better! Tension your pads to emulate your acoustic drum set up. I am using the DW 5000 heelless pedal w/ plastic beater w/ pedal plate [helps stabilize the kick]. The kick pedal is garbage should have not included it and lowered the price point. Titan 70
